  • Stochastic Differential Equation Methods for Spatio-Temporal Gaussian Process Regression

    Arno Solin, M.Sc. (Tech.), will defend the dissertation "Stochastic Differential Equation Methods for Spatio-Temporal Gaussian Process Regression" on 8.4.2016 at 12 noon in Aalto University School of Science, lecture hall F239a, Otakaari 3, Espoo. In the dissertation, computationally efficient methods for modelling spatio-temporal data were developed. The work provides a link...

  • 07.04.2016 16:30–18:30
    Event
    Päivälehden museo, Ludviginkatu 2-4, Helsinki

    (English summary only, the event will be in Finnish.)

    Digivaalit 2015 analyzed the use of the digital media and agenda setting processes in the Finnish parliamentary elections in 2015. We study the normalization of agenda control and apply computational techniques in social science context.

    Normalization hypothesis suggests that the practices in online media will be formed and...
